What Is an All-Terrain Buggy?
An all-terrain buggy is an automobile created to drive on a range of surface areas, consisting of dirt, mud, sand, and gravel. These buggies generally feature robust chassis, effective engines, and resilient tires, making them efficient in navigating challenging landscapes. They are frequently enjoyed in leisure settings, be it rural areas, parks, or off-road routes.

When shopping for an all-terrain buggy, several key functions must be thought about to ensure you choose the best one for your requirements. Below is a list of the most essential features to keep in mind:
Engine Power: An effective engine will permit your buggy to tackle more tough terrains. Look for options ranging from 150cc to 1000cc, depending upon your needs.
Tires: The kind of tires affects traction and grip. Pick between knobby tires for mud/sand or all-terrain tires for mixed use.
Suspension System: An advanced suspension system can deal with rough terrains much better, supplying a smoother ride.
Security Features: Look for roll cages, seat belts, lights, and mirrors to make sure optimum security while driving.
Comfort: Consider the seating capability and comfort functions such as adjustable seats and roominess.
Weight Capacity: This is crucial for carrying passengers or cargo if you intend on using the buggy for energy functions.
Adaptability: Some buggies provide attachments or modular designs that enable them to carry out several functions.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ION: All-Terrain Buggies1. Are all-terrain buggies street-legal?
It depends on the model and where you live. Some buggies can be customized to be made road legal, but the majority of are mostly created for off-road use.
2. What security gear do I require?
It is encouraged to wear a helmet, safety glasses, and protective clothes. Examine local laws as regulations might vary.
3. How fast can all-terrain buggies go?
This can vary considerably based on the model. A lot of leisure buggies can reach speeds between 30 to 70 miles per hour.
4. Can I use an all-terrain buggy for work purposes?
Yes, lots of utility buggies are clearly designed for work, capable of carrying tools and materials across different terrains.
5. What upkeep do all-terrain buggies need?
Routine upkeep includes checking and changing oil, examining tires, brakes, and the engine. Always follow the producer's standards.
